Micron Memory Nvidia Premium Pricing Leaves Stock at Six Times Forward Earnings

When Nvidia filed its fiscal second-quarter 2027 results on August 26, disclosing record revenue of $96.2 billion, the clearest external confirmation of Micron Technology’s pricing leverage sat inside the same release. Chief Financial Officer Colette Kress stated that memory costs had exceeded Nvidia’s internal modeling, were still rising, and would compress gross margins from 75% in the second quarter to a trough of 71% to 72% by the fourth quarter of fiscal 2027 before a partial recovery in fiscal 2028 once Nvidia’s own price increases take hold. The data point that sharpens the Micron memory Nvidia premium pricing narrative is procurement: Nvidia’s supply commitments swelled to $279 billion, up from $119 billion the prior quarter, primarily to lock in memory at current rates.

That margin pressure does not vanish. It transfers. On a quarter guided to roughly $108 billion in revenue, each percentage point of gross margin represents about $1.1 billion, and only three companies on earth manufacture the high-bandwidth memory absorbing the cost: Samsung, SK Hynix, and Micron. Within two trading sessions of Nvidia’s report, all three suppliers gained between 3% and 5%, according to Motley Fool analyst Anders Bylund’s August 28 note. Yet Micron trades at approximately six times its fiscal 2027 consensus earnings, against a semiconductor industry forward P/E median of 29.18, an 80% gap.

Nvidia Earnings Reveal the Magnitude of Micron Memory Nvidia Premium Pricing

High-bandwidth memory now accounts for an estimated 30% to 40% of the total build cost of an AI accelerator, up from under 20% two generations ago. Every dollar Nvidia pays above its prior expectations for HBM is a dollar landing on the income statement of one of three suppliers. Kress’s framing of the situation is unusually direct. She confirmed that Nvidia has already negotiated price increases slated to take effect in the first quarter of fiscal 2028, meaning the margin compression is the interval between when Nvidia begins paying more for memory and when it begins charging more to its own customers.

Investors will focus on Nvidia’s November 17 report for confirmation that the trough holds at 71% to 72%. A stable range supports the timing interpretation. A deteriorating range would suggest memory manufacturers are capturing more than Nvidia budgeted, converting the fiscal 2028 recovery from a firm plan into a softer forecast. For Micron, Jensen Huang cleared the company alongside Samsung and SK Hynix in June 2026 to supply HBM4 for Nvidia’s Vera Rubin platform, locking Micron into the top tier of the AI memory roadmap and confirming technical parity with the two Korean incumbents that have historically dominated HBM market share.

Why the Valuation Discount Persists Despite HBM4 Qualification

Micron shares sit roughly 29% below their 52-week peak even as the company’s HBM capacity is fully booked for 2026. The analyst consensus price target stands at approximately $1,295 to $1,318, implying upside of 69% or more depending on the reference date. The discount reflects a specific and durable concern: the market is pricing in a repeat of the historical DRAM boom-bust pattern, in which memory manufacturers build capacity in parallel during an upturn, oversupply the market, and watch prices collapse. In the prior downturn, Micron’s gross margins fell from 45.2% in fiscal 2022 to approximately 2.7% in fiscal 2023. A forward P/E of six on projected earnings implies the market assigns meaningful probability that those projections will not materialize.

The bear case carries a recognizable name. Michael Burry, the investor who identified the 2008 housing crisis, has quietly assembled a short position against Micron, adding to it near $924 per share on the thesis that AI data-center oversupply could emerge by 2028. He has simultaneously placed shorts against Oracle and Nebius, framing the call as a broader AI infrastructure overcapacity argument rather than a company-specific one. Citi Research analyst Atif Malik, who maintains a Buy rating, trimmed his Micron price target from $1,400 to $1,150 in August 2026, citing potential deceleration in DRAM and NAND prices over the next four quarters. Goldman Sachs, by contrast, has revised its 2027 DRAM shortage forecast sharply upward to a 5.9% supply deficit and described the current market as the most severe memory shortage in 15 years.

What Separates This Cycle From Prior DRAM Busts

The bull case rests on three structural changes that the cyclical bear argument does not fully incorporate. First, the wafer economics of high-bandwidth memory differ from conventional DRAM. HBM stacks multiple DRAM dies vertically, connects them through microscopic copper channels called through-silicon vias, and co-packages the resulting stack directly beside a GPU on a silicon interposer. The manufacturing complexity raises the capital cost per gigabit and lengthens the qualification cycle, slowing the speed at which incremental supply reaches the market.

Second, customer concentration has shifted. The buyers of leading-edge HBM are a small set of AI accelerator designers, primarily Nvidia, AMD, and a handful of custom silicon programs at hyperscalers. That concentration gives memory suppliers visibility on multi-quarter demand that did not exist in the fragmented PC and smartphone DRAM market of prior cycles. Third, the packaging step that combines HBM with a logic die is now a binding constraint. CoWoS and similar interposer-based flows are gated by foundry capacity at Taiwan Semiconductor Manufacturing Company, meaning that even if DRAM wafer output expanded rapidly, finished HBM units could not ship without matched advanced packaging capacity.

Burry’s Bear Case Against the Micron Memory Nvidia Premium Pricing Thesis

Burry’s public filings point to a 2028 horizon, by which point he expects AI data-center buildouts to exceed end-demand for inference and training compute. If that view is correct, accelerator shipments slow, HBM orders contract, and the premium currently embedded in memory pricing collapses toward historical norms. The thesis gains credibility from the gross margin history. Micron’s fiscal 2023 trough of 2.7% remains a recent memory for institutional investors who carry cycle-aware position sizing into every upturn. Citi’s Malik reduction to $1,150 indicates that even bullish houses are hedging the timeline.

Goldman Sachs’s 5.9% deficit forecast cuts the other way, suggesting supply remains structurally tight into 2027 even if end-demand softens. The contradiction between the two research notes is itself the market’s central uncertainty. What Nvidia’s August 26 disclosure settled is that, at minimum, the next three quarters of memory pricing will run above prior expectations, and that all three qualified HBM4 suppliers, including Micron, will capture the spread. Whether that spread persists into fiscal 2029 is the open question that will determine whether six times forward earnings is a value trap or the entry point of the cycle for Micron memory Nvidia premium pricing exposure.
